in the USAHenderson State University is a very small public college offering a number of disciplines along with the sport program and located in
Arkadelphia,
Arkansas. The school was founded in 1890 and is currently offering master's degrees in Sport and Fitness Administration.
Henderson State University is rather inexpensive: depending on the program, tuition varies around $11,000 a year. If you are seeking a cheaper alternative, check
